Social Marketing Executive:

We are on the look-out for an enthusiastic and highly motivated Social Marketing Executive, primarily to manage our client’s social platforms and their paid advertising.

 

The successful applicant will work to produce inspirational and strategic social campaigns with the goal to increase conversion rates. 

In addition you should have a very good mind for analytics as you will need to identify if these are on track as well as diagnose when they’re not. You will join a team of passionate digital marketers and will be expected to report on your accounts on a regular basis, both internally to our Head of Digital, Emily, and directly to our clients.

You will be confident and competent to be able to create both organic social content and paid advertising campaigns across relevant platforms. You will be expected to implement, monitor and report on your strategy and results.

 

The ideal candidate will;

  • Confident and capable of planning, implementing and optimising paid advertising strategies for social media
  • Have an understanding of Meta and Linkedin Analytics
  • Have experience in Facebook Ads Manager and Linkedin Campaign Manager
  • Comfortable in dealing with large scale budgets
  • Have experience creating both organic and paid social media campaigns that reflect individual tones and objectives
  • Able to communicate and collaborate effectively with the rest of the digital marketing team
  • Confident in analysis and report effectively, to both our Head of Digital and directly to our clients
  • Be self motivated and driven to achieve the best possible results at all times
  • Capable of practising strict quality control and be able to communicate the English language to a high standard
  • Be confident in managing multiple accounts simultaneously

Whilst this is preferably a full time role, part time hours can be considered.

Digital Marketing Executive:

We are on the look-out for an enthusiastic and highly motivated Digital Marketing Executive, primarily to manage our client’s websites and their digital strategies.

The successful applicant will work to produce inspirational content for distribution around the web. You will assist with website copywriting and content insertion, as well as occasional press releases.

In addition you should have a very good mind for analytics as you will be trained to carry out our in-house technical web audits and will be expected to report on your accounts on a regular basis, both internally to our Head of Digital, Emily, and directly to our clients.

You will be confident and competent to be able to create and manage digital marketing strategies and monitor and report on your results.

 

The ideal candidate will;

  • Have experience in Search Engine Optimisation (SEO) and Conversion Optimisation
  • Have an understanding of Google Analytics & Tag Manager
  • Have experience in client liaison and account handling
  • Be able to create campaigns that reflect our client’s individual tones and objectives.
  • Be able to communicate and collaborate effectively with the rest of the digital marketing team.
  • Have a high standard of written English
  • Analyse and report effectively, to both our Head of Digital and directly to our clients.
  • Be self motivated and driven to achieve the best possible results at all times.
  • Be confident in managing multiple accounts simultaneously.

     

If you are highly organised, driven to gain results and experienced in digital marketing we would love to hear from you (a friendly disposition never goes amiss either!). Whilst this is preferably a full time role, part time hours will be considered.
